Tony Jackson Jr. takes on Spring Nationals

A trip to the "Diamond of Dirt Tracks” was on the schedule for Tony Jackson Jr. over the weekend for a pair of Super Late Model shows. While Jackson qualified for both feature events during the 12th annual Spring Nationals at Wheatland, Missouri’s Lucas Oil Speedway, each came to a disappointing end.

With 43 Super Late Models at the 3/8-mile oval on Friday, Jackson drove his No. 56 Schlup Enterprises machine to third in his heat race and started ninth in the night’s 40-lap, $7,000 to-win feature. He suffered a DNF and was scored with a 23rd-place result.

On Saturday, Jackson raced among 40 Super Late Model drivers looking to capture the evening's $20,000 first-place check. Jackson won his heat, putting him fourth on the grid to begin the 60-lap main event. He maintained a top-five position early, but ran into trouble just before halfway and failed to finish for the second night in a row. He was scored 20th in the final rundown.
